Chitty Chitty Bang Bang

Chitty Chitty Bang Bang

Member rating

1,329 reviews

An unsuccessful inventor rescues an old car which acquires magic properties.

CertificateU

Duration146 mins

Review by Iman, 11

5 stars

18 Jun 2015

At first, I thought it would be very boring and that the film would not be my type at all seeing as I rarely ever watch movies from four years ago let alone the 1960's. However it turned out to be quite spectacular with a grand finale that took us all by surprise. Now I feel that I want to watch more movies around the late 19th century because they are very fascinating and funny. Also: the singing was out of this world and the songs are now stuck in my head. This movie and its actors are quite amazing which makes me want to watch it again and again..I even went to search for them online! *sighs* If I could choose one word to describe this film it would be PERFECT. I loved it.
